Strategic Storage Solutions for Effective Clutter Management
decluttering your home can be a transformative process, offering both mental clarity and physical space. A key aspect of this endeavor is implementing strategic storage solutions that cater to your specific needs and the layout of your living spaces. Home Organization and Decluttering begin with an assessment of what you own versus what you actually use. Once you have a clear understanding of your belongings, you can then strategically utilize storage options that maximize space and minimize clutter. For instance, consider incorporating versatile furniture pieces like ottomans with built-in storage or beds with drawers underneath. These items not only serve their primary function but also provide hidden spaces for items that are used infrequently. Another approach is to invest in modular storage systems, which can be customized to fit various areas of your home, from the entryway to the bedroom closet. These systems often include adjustable shelves and dividers that can adapt as your storage needs change over time. Utilizing clear containers for these spaces not only keeps items organized but also makes them easily identifiable. Room-Specific Decluttering Tips to Maintain a Clutter-Free Zone
Creating and maintaining a clutter-free home requires a strategic approach, especially when considering room-specific organization. In the realm of kitchen organization, for instance, prioritize space by categorizing items into daily use and occasional use. Regularly assess your kitchen tools and appliances; if certain items haven’t been used within the past year, consider donating them to make room for what you truly need. Implementing clear storage solutions and designating specific areas for different types of food, such as pantry space for dry goods and refrigerator shelves for perishables, will contribute to a streamlined and efficient kitchen environment.
Similarly, in the living areas of your home, consider the function each item serves. Bookshelves can be both decorative and functional when curated thoughtfully, displaying keepsakes, favorite books, and often-used electronics. The key is to differentiate between items that add value to your daily life and those that merely accumulate dust. Regularly rotate less frequently used items, such as seasonal decorations or off-season clothing, to other storage spaces, ensuring that living areas remain clutter-free and inviting. To effectively declutter and organize your home, it’s beneficial to adopt a systematic approach. Start with one area at a time, sorting through each item with the minimalist principles in mind: keep, donate, sell, or discard. This process not only frees up physical space but also mental clutter, as you make decisions that align with your lifestyle and values.
